
North Douglas MHK Bill Henderson says he’s washing his hands of Allan Bell’s administration after being thrown out of his Treasury job.
On Friday, Treasury Minister Eddie Teare sacked him, accusing him of going back on a promise to support the government’s higher education tuition fee plans.
But Mr Henderson denies promising anything, claiming his manifesto pledges meant he couldn’t vote with the government.
